According to the​ text, the best downward communicators​ ________________________.
Zinaida [17]

Answer:D. explain the reasons behind their communications and solicit feedback

Explanation:

Downward communication refers to how the information is transferred downwards formally from the higher levels to the lower levels in an organization hierarchy. This means that what ever message or direction or orders intended for everyone in the organization start from the higher managerial positions and passes down

Advantages

Discipline in the organization,

Efficiency and Effective communication of goals , easily communication of the goals that need to be achieved and guidance towards those goals.

Disadvantages

Distortion message can get lost along the way and others may not find it as it was originally sent, slow feedback cause it may take time to reach all levels, Interpretative problems

Adrienne is a 16-year-old girl who is searching for her identity. Which of the following would NOT be an example of the search f
juin [17]

Answer:

Option D

She would describe herself solely in terms of physical characteristics.

Explanation:

The self concept was said by Carl Rogers to have 3 major components:

1. Self Image

2. Self Esteem

3. The Ideal Self

These are qualities that transcend mere physical appearance. The self concept does not deal primarily on the physical features of an individual, rather the intangible qualities like character, emotions, motivation and values.

Hence, the self concept includes all options in the question above but option D making it the correct answer
